Monthly Cost of Living
🙂Monthly costs for one person with rent: $712 in Ozamiz versus $931 in Cebu.
🙂Estimated couple costs with rent: $1,080 in Ozamiz versus $1,439 in Cebu.
🙂Monthly costs for a family of three with rent: $1,448 in Ozamiz versus $1,947 in Cebu.
🌍Living in Ozamiz costs roughly 23% less than in Cebu, driven mainly by Groceries & Markets.
📊Both cities sit below the global median: Ozamiz48% lower, Cebu32% lower.

Cost Breakdown
🏠A one-bedroom apartment in the center runs $266 in Ozamiz and $489 in Cebu. Housing cost is often the main lever when comparing two cities.
💰Cebu pays 74% more on average. The extra income cushions the higher costs, though housing choices and lifestyle decide how much of the gap is truly closed.
🛒Dining out: $16.00 in Ozamiz vs $23.00 in Cebu for a mid-range dinner for two. Groceries echo the gap at $169 vs $208 per month, with Ozamiz cheaper across the board.
